Representations and Warranties of OGE; Performance. (i) The representations and warranties of OGE set forth in Article IV made to ETP (other than those set forth in Section 4.3) shall be true and correct in all respects as of the Execution Date and as of the Closing as if remade on the date thereof (except for representations and warranties made as of a specific date, which shall be true and correct as of such specific date), except for such failures to be true and correct (ignoring and disregarding all Materiality Requirements set forth therein (other than in Section 4.17(b)) that could not, individually or when aggregated with other such inaccuracies of representations or warranties, reasonably be expected to have an Enogex Material Adverse Effect, (ii) the representations and warranties of OGE set forth in Section 4.3 shall be true and correct in all material respects as of the Execution Date and as of the Closing, as if remade on the date thereof (except for representations and warranties made as of a specific date, which shall be true and correct as of such specific date), (iii) OGE shall have performed (or caused to have been performed) all covenants required of it by this Agreement as of the Closing and (iv) OGE shall have furnished to ETP at the Closing with a certificate to such effect.
